Job Summary
The Quality Control Manager (QCM) is responsible for the overall planning, implementation, and management of Construction Quality Control (CQC) activities on assigned projects. The QCM ensures all work complies with contract requirements, project specifications, applicable codes, and industry standards. This role leads the development and execution of quality assurance and quality control procedures, oversees inspections and testing, manages quality documentation, and directs corrective actions for nonconforming work. The QCM coordinates closely with project management, subcontractors, inspectors, and clients to proactively identify and resolve quality issues, ensure deficiencies are corrected in a timely manner, and maintain high standards of workmanship. The QCM will assume the essential functions of an Assistant QCM as appropriate.
Essential Functions
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
- Lead, manage, and develop Assistant QCMs. Provide training and ensure compliance and adherence of QC tasks and applicable software based on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s). Set quality control expectations and monitor, as needed. Provide constructive coaching and feedback related to performance and development opportunities.
- Partner with the project team to lead project start-up. Assist SSHO with obtaining dig permits and hot-work permits. Establish a project submittal register. Review the contract documents for constructability. Participate in preconstruction meetings with subcontractors to set project expectations. Participate in post-award meetings with USACE. Collect Division 1 submittals, accident prevent plans (APPs), QC plans, SWPP, etc. Set-up third-party inspectors.
- Conduct testing and field inspections. Submit testing and inspections in RMS and construction management software. Coordinate inspections with USACE, providing maps and invitations accordingly. Coordinate inspection and testing requirements for each definable feature of work (DFOW) with subcontractors. Coordinate with third-party inspectors. Conduct daily inspections and photo documentation to ensure quality of work. Generate deficiencies and observations in construction management software; follow up to ensure completion. Hold subcontractors accountable to address deficient work; review final work product for acceptability.
- Submit project documentation for USACE approval in RMS. Request and review submittals from subcontractors. Track delivery of materials received; verify and document that all materials received for the project are in conformance with the approved submittals, are handled and stored appropriately, and are acceptable for use on the project. Ensure all preconstruction submittals are complete prior to starting work. Review all RFIs for validity prior to processing. Populate data for daily project reports in RMS (weather delays, inspections, project progress, manpower, deficiencies).
- Implement the three phases of quality control inspections. Lead the preparatory meetings with subcontractors to discuss contract requirements. Ensure subcontractors are adhering to the most current sets of drawings and specifications. Hold initial inspections in the field to review preliminary work. Coordinate with USACE for resolution of any unforeseen conditions, modifications, or general government direction. Hold follow up inspections in the field to review work, as needed. Lead QC meetings with Bryan Construction and subcontractors, as needed, to ensure proper quality in the field. Attend subcontractor progress meetings and OAC meetings.
- Partner with the project team to lead project closeout. Request and review O&Ms submitted by subcontractors and coordinate owner training, as needed. Develop a spare parts list. Collect warranty documentation from all subcontractors. Coordinate testing and balancing (TAB) and commissioning for the project. Coordinate pre-final and final inspections; create punchlist items, track and closeout. Ensure all subcontractors keep up with red-lined changes and coordinate final as-built drawings. Compile data for the 1354 form. Populate data for transfer of property.
- Support safety process. Stop work if necessary to resolve matters that affect safety, quality, and/or inhibit the logical progress of work.
